EmDash와 WordPress 기술스택, 플러그인, 테마 특징 비교 및 EmDash 설치

넥스트플랫폼 동준상 대표 (naebon@naver.com)

2026.04.05 / 동준상.넥스트플랫폼 (naebon@naver.com)
(AWS SAA, AWS AIF, GCP GenAI Leader)

AIGrape Icon by NextPlatform
AIGrape

이번 포스트는 AIGrape AUTO 모드로 작성하고,
인포그래픽 등 이미지는 NotebookLM으로 제작했습니다.


핵심 정리

  • WordPress는 전 세계 웹사이트의 40% 이상을 구동하는 CMS 거인입니다. 20년간 쌓아온 생태계와 커뮤니티는 압도적이지만, 플러그인 보안 취약점(96% 보안 문제 원인), 서버 비용, 속도 최적화 부담이라는 구조적 한계를 안고 있습니다.
  • EmDash는 Cloudflare가 개발한 차세대 오픈소스 CMS로, WordPress의 정신을 계승하면서도 TypeScript 기반 서버리스 아키텍처로 완전히 재설계되었습니다. 플러그인 샌드박스 격리, 내장 x402 결제, AI 네이티브 관리 등 2026년 웹 환경에 최적화된 기능을 제공합니다.
  • 결론 예고: WordPress는 성숙한 생태계가 필요한 대규모 프로젝트에, EmDash는 보안·성능·비용 효율이 중요한 현대적 프로젝트에 적합합니다.

EmDash vs WordPress 비교 분석

1. 주요 특징 비교

항목WordPressEmDash
기술 스택PHP + MySQL
서버 프로비저닝 필요
TypeScript + Cloudflare Workers
서버리스 (scale-to-zero)
플러그인 구조수만 개 플러그인
직접 DB/파일 접근
GPL 라이선스 제약
샌드박스 격리 실행
명시적 권한 요청 (예: read:content)
MIT 라이선스 자유화
테마 시스템PHP 파일 구조
functions.php로 전체 접근
Astro 프레임워크 기반
Pages/Layouts/Components
DB 접근 불가 (보안 강화)
콘텐츠 형식HTML 중심
Custom Post Type
Portable Text JSON
API/앱 재활용 최적화
수익화WooCommerce 등 플러그인 의존내장 x402 결제 표준
pay-per-use 콘텐츠 결제
AI 트래픽 시대 대응
AI/현대 기능플러그인 추가 필요내장 MCP·CLI·Agent Skills
Passkey 인증 기본
배포VPS/호스팅 설정 필요npm create emdash@latest
Cloudflare 대시보드 원클릭

실무 인사이트: WordPress는 편집 워크플로우가 복잡한 미디어 기업에, EmDash는 간단한 콘텐츠 팀이나 고트래픽 서비스에 적합합니다.


2. 장단점 비교

WordPress 장단점

✅ 장점

  • 성숙한 생태계: 6만+ 플러그인, 1만+ 테마, 20년 커뮤니티 자산
  • SEO 최강자: Yoast 등 플러그인으로 검색 상위 노출 용이
  • 다국어·멤버십 완벽: 대규모 편집팀 워크플로우 지원
  • 레퍼런스 풍부: 튜토리얼, 포럼, 개발자 풀 압도적

❌ 단점

  • 보안 취약: 플러그인이 DB/파일 직접 접근 → 96% 해킹 원인
  • 속도 문제: 플러그인 훅 과다 시 로딩 지연 (캐싱 플러그인 필수)
  • 서버 비용: 유휴 리소스 비용 발생, VPS 관리 부담
  • GPL 제약: 플러그인 상업화 제한, 중앙 마켓플레이스 종속

실무 팁: 플러그인 10개 이하 유지, AWS Lightsail 등 관리형 호스팅 필수

EmDash 장단점

✅ 장점

  • 혁신적 보안: 플러그인 V8 isolate 격리 → 권한 명시 (OAuth 방식)
  • 초고속 성능: 기본 최적화, CDN 내장, SEO 크롤링 유리
  • 저비용: CPU 사용 시간만 과금, 무료 티어 강력
  • AI 네이티브: MCP 서버 내장, 콘텐츠 마이그레이션 자동화
  • 라이선스 자유: 개발자가 플러그인 라이선스 선택 가능

❌ 단점

  • 초기 단계: v0.1.0 프리뷰, 플러그인·테마 생태계 부족
  • 워크플로우 단순: 복잡한 편집 프로세스에는 아직 제한적
  • Cloudflare 의존: Workers 플랫폼 종속성 (Node.js 로컬 실행 가능하지만)
  • 커뮤니티 규모: WordPress 대비 초기 단계

실무 팁: 간단한 블로그나 고트래픽 콘텐츠 서비스에서 시작, 마이그레이션 쉬움


3. 기술적 차이점 심층 비교

보안 아키텍처

WordPressEmDash
플러그인 = PHP 스크립트
DB/파일 전체 접근 권한
설치 시 거의 모든 권한 부여
플러그인 = Dynamic Worker isolate
manifest로 권한 명시 (read:content, email:send 등)
네트워크 접근도 명시된 호스트만

실제 사례: WordPress 사이트는 오래된 플러그인 하나로 전체 해킹 가능. EmDash는 플러그인이 요청한 권한만 부여 → 관리자가 설치 전 권한 확인 가능 (앱스토어 방식).

성능 및 비용

WordPressEmDash
서버 항시 가동 → 유휴 비용 발생
트래픽 급증 시 수동 스케일링
캐싱 플러그인 별도 필요
요청 시 인스턴스 생성 (cold start 최소화)
무트래픽 시 자동 scale-to-zero
CDN 기본 내장, CPU 사용 시간만 과금

비용 예시: 월 1만 PV 블로그 기준

  • WordPress: VPS $10~50/월
  • EmDash: Cloudflare 무료 티어 또는 $5 미만

콘텐츠 및 배포

  • 콘텐츠 구조
  • WordPress: HTML 중심, Custom Post Type으로 확장
  • EmDash: Portable Text JSON → 앱·API 재활용 용이, AI 처리 최적
  • 배포 프로세스
  • WordPress: FTP/SSH 업로드, 서버 설정, DB 마이그레이션
  • EmDash: npm create emdash@latest 또는 Cloudflare 대시보드 원클릭

시사점 및 FAQ

시사점

  1. EmDash는 WordPress의 ‘정신적 후속작’: 출판 민주화 철학 계승 + 2026 웹 환경(AI, 서버리스) 최적화
  2. 보안 패러다임 전환: 플러그인 격리는 CMS 보안의 새 표준이 될 가능성
  3. 수익화 혁신: x402 결제는 AI 에이전트 기반 웹 트래픽 시대의 핵심 인프라
  4. 하이브리드 전략: WordPress 백엔드 + EmDash 프론트엔드 조합도 고려 가치

FAQ

Q1. 언제 EmDash를 선택해야 하나요?
A: 보안·성능이 최우선이거나, 간단한 콘텐츠 팀, 고트래픽 서비스, AI 기반 자동화가 필요한 경우. 복잡한 워크플로우는 아직 WordPress가 유리.

Q2. WordPress에서 EmDash로 마이그레이션이 쉬운가요?
A: 매우 쉽습니다. WXR 파일 내보내기 또는 EmDash Exporter 플러그인으로 콘텐츠·미디어 자동 이전. Custom Post Type은 EmDash 컬렉션으로 변환.

Q3. 커뮤니티 지원은 어떤가요?
A: WordPress는 20년 커뮤니티 자산 압도적. EmDash는 GitHub에서 성장 중이며 Cloudflare 공식 지원. 초기 도입자에게는 리스크와 기회가 공존.

Q4. 플러그인 생태계는?
A: WordPress 6만+ vs EmDash 초기 단계. 하지만 EmDash는 AI Agent Skills로 커스터마이징 자동화 가능 → 플러그인 의존도 낮출 수 있음.

Q5. 비용은 어떻게 되나요?
A: EmDash가 압도적 저렴. 무료 티어로 중소 사이트 충분, 대규모도 CPU 과금으로 WordPress VPS 대비 30~50% 절감 가능.

Q6. Cloudflare 없이 사용 가능한가요?
A: 가능합니다. Node.js 서버에서 로컬 실행 지원. 하지만 Workers 기반 배포가 최적 성능.


참고자료

공식 문서 및 저장소

심층 분석 자료

커뮤니티


마치며: EmDash는 아직 초기 단계지만, WordPress가 해결하지 못한 구조적 문제를 정면 돌파한 야심찬 프로젝트입니다. 당장 전환하기보다는, 새 프로젝트나 사이드 프로젝트에서 시험해보며 생태계 성장을 지켜보는 전략을 추천합니다. WordPress의 20년 자산과 EmDash의 현대적 설계, 둘 다 배울 점이 많습니다. 🚀

답글 남기기